Output 3df3184699298c69eb421610a12c4318bd03d3ba6106a8e4a064165ddf72e53e:0

value
14285909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05dab49e0fa39c4ba26a526355613207b5d95f26 OP_EQUAL
address
32DyJRto8P6DF61RGMWQDGXDNFDuVrFr6i
transaction
3df3184699298c69eb421610a12c4318bd03d3ba6106a8e4a064165ddf72e53e
confirmations
284013
spent
true